Ionizable Lipid‐Dependent Optimization of Steroid Lipid Nanoparticles With Tunable Immunomodulatory Properties

open access: yesAdvanced Materials, EarlyView.
A novel engineering strategy that establishes material design principles for incorporating anti‐inflammatory steroids into lipid nanoparticles to reduce LNP‐induced inflammation while retaining mRNA delivery. Results are validated in vitro and in three animal models of inflammation and autoimmunity in vivo.
